Output 58bf7384ceeadf57c47b1b76f29caf0ad6b526dd134edb5852bf2c586605932c:1

value
5176580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7db603e42226773f8ad6e3293a82738c0bba8e OP_EQUAL
address
34CNmGywn4xPUdFL99No7ceCoZNQwfZai9
transaction
58bf7384ceeadf57c47b1b76f29caf0ad6b526dd134edb5852bf2c586605932c
spent
true